Indholdsfortegnelse:

Beskrivelse

KUN TILGÆNGELIG I TEST

DeletePerson anvendes til at slette hele datasættet for en personregistrering. Vedligehold af information knyttet til en person håndteres via eCPR - UpdatePerson. Der er dog den væsentlige forskel, at ved inaktivering af underelementer via eCPR - UpdatePerson vil indholdet stadig være søgbart, således at der eksempelvis kan søges på et udløbet pasnummer. Ved anvendelse af DeletePerson vil data ikke længere være søgbare.

Personen der skal slettes angives via en KeyIdentifier. Hvis sletningen lykkes, returnerer servicen et tomt svar.

Forespørgsel

Request-eksempel (simplificeret):

<DeletePersonRequest>
  <Person>
    <KeyIdentifier>
      <OID>1.2.208.176.1.6.1.1</OID>
      <Value>1212901TX9</Value>
    </KeyIdentifier>
    <Modified>
      <By>
        <Person>
          <AuthorisationIdentifier>AB01C</AuthorisationIdentifier>
          <Name>Jens Jensen</Name>
          <PersonIdentifier>1234567890</PersonIdentifier>
        </Person>
        <Role>Læge</Role>
        <Organisation>
          <Name>Andeby hospital</Name>
          <Type>Hospital</Type>
          <Identifier>
            <Identifier>1234123412</Identifier>
            <Source>SOR</Source>
          </Identifier>
        </Organisation>
      </By>
    </Modified>
  </Person>
</DeletePersonRequest>

Svar

Response-eksempel (simplificeret):

<DeletePersonResponse/>

Ændringslog

1.02023-11-08Indhold publiceretSDS





  • No labels